Close #296: Proper plurals
Use the provided plural mechanisms of QT.
The "PO" translation also works smoothly and
the translation mechanisms between .po <-> .qt
was tested successfully.

The new english translation file translates
the single phrase:
 "Delete the %n revocation list(s): '%1'?"
into
 "Delete the revocation list: '%1'?" for one item
and
 "Delete the %n revocation lists: '%1'?" otherwise

/* vi: set sw=4 ts=4:
*
* Copyright (C) 2001 - 2020 Christian Hohnstaedt.
*
* All rights reserved.
*/
#ifndef __PKI_TEMP_H
#define __PKI_TEMP_H
#include "pki_base.h"
#include "x509name.h"
#include "asn1time.h"
#include "pki_x509super.h"
#define D5 "-----"
#define PEM_STRING_XCA_TEMPLATE "XCA TEMPLATE"
#define TMPL_VERSION 10
#define CHECK_TMPL_KEY if (!tmpl_keys.contains(key)) { qFatal("Unknown template key: %s(%s)", __func__, CCHAR(key)); }
#define VIEW_temp_version 6
#define VIEW_temp_template 7
class pki_temp: public pki_x509name
{
Q_OBJECT
protected:
static const QList<QString> tmpl_keys;
int dataSize();
void try_fload(XFile &file);
bool pre_defined{ false };
x509name xname{};
QMap<QString, QString> settings{};
QString adv_ext{};
void fromExtList(extList *el, int nid, const char *item);
public:
pki_temp(const pki_temp *pk);
pki_temp(const QString &d = QString());
~pki_temp();
QString getSetting(const QString &key)
{
CHECK_TMPL_KEY
return settings[key];
}
int getSettingInt(const QString &key)
{
CHECK_TMPL_KEY
return settings[key].toInt();
}
void setSetting(const QString &key, const QString &value)
{
CHECK_TMPL_KEY
settings[key] = value;
}
void setSetting(const QString &key, int value)
{
CHECK_TMPL_KEY
settings[key] = QString::number(value);
}
void fload(const QString &fname);
void writeDefault(const QString &dirname) const ;
void fromData(const unsigned char *p, int size, int version);
void old_fromData(const unsigned char *p, int size, int version);
void fromData(QByteArray &ba, int version);
void setAsPreDefined()
{
pre_defined = true;
}
QString comboText() const;
QByteArray toData(bool for_export = false) const;
QString toB64Data()
{
return QString::fromLatin1(toData().toBase64());
}
bool compare(const pki_base *ref) const;
void writeTemp(XFile &file) const;
QVariant getIcon(const dbheader *hd) const;
QString getMsg(msg_type msg, int n = 1) const;
x509name getSubject() const;
void setSubject(x509name n)
{
xname = n;
}
bool pem(BioByteArray &);
QByteArray toExportData() const;
void fromPEM_BIO(BIO *, const QString &);
void fromExportData(QByteArray data);
extList fromCert(pki_x509super *cert_or_req);
QSqlError insertSqlData();
QSqlError deleteSqlData();
void restoreSql(const QSqlRecord &rec);
void autoIntName(const QString &file);
};
Q_DECLARE_METATYPE(pki_temp *);
#endif
